Swinomish Oysters

Chef's Resources

Swinomish Oysters Flavor Profile See image licensing info Swinomish oysters are a new Pacific Oyster variety, or perhaps better stated, a returning variety, from Similk Bay in the Northern Puget Sound area of Washington State. The Swinomish tribe originally raised oysters from 1935 to 1969 on the tidelands of Padilla and Skagit bays. They are […].

PROSECCO PREPARES FOR CLIMATE CHANGE

Planet Grape

Food and Wine. Prosecco Prepares for Climate Change. Catherine Fallis. Fri Nov 22. A hilly corner of the Veneto in northern Italy was awarded Unesco World Heritage designation this past July, and odds are you are already familiar with it. It is the area known as Conegliano Valdobbiadene in the heart of Prosecco country. But is this designation enough to save the vineyards from global warming?
